English: Delaware Army National Guard members provide flood rescue support in Wilmington, Sept. 2, 2021 alongside local fire departments and police to assist community members who were stranded after heavy rains drenched the area and covered the roads with standing water. (Army National Guard photos by Spc. Alyssa Lisenbe)
